diff options
Diffstat (limited to 'tests/lexer/tind1.nim')
-rw-r--r-- | tests/lexer/tind1.nim |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/tests/lexer/tind1.nim b/tests/lexer/tind1.nim new file mode 100644 index 000000000..2185c3074 --- /dev/null +++ b/tests/lexer/tind1.nim @@ -0,0 +1,25 @@ +discard """ + errormsg: "invalid indentation" + line: 24 +""" + +import macros + +# finally optional indentation in 'if' expressions :-): +var x = if 4 != 5: + "yes" + else: + "no" + +macro mymacro(n, b): untyped = + discard + +mymacro: + echo "test" +else: + echo "else part" + +if 4 == 3: + echo "bug" + else: + echo "no bug" |